Mastering the Core Mechanics Online

To succeed in Street Fighter Alpha 3 online, you need a solid grasp of the series fundamentals, like canceling normals into special moves and building meter for powerful Super Combos. The game rewards precise timing, so training mode remains essential for nailing bread and butter combos. Understanding frame data, hitstun, and spacing will give you a consistent edge when you face other players online.

Here are some key concepts to focus on as you learn the online meta:

  • Chain combos that let you juggle opponents with clever cancel links.
  • Alpha Counters that punish whiffed attacks and open up big damage windows.
  • Custom combos that let you burn meter for enhanced moves and extended routes.
Once these ideas become second nature, you can start experimenting with mixups, crossups, and pressure strings that keep your rivals guessing.

Choosing Your Character and Playstyle

Street Fighter Alpha 3 online offers a deep roster, and picking the right fighter is crucial for long term enjoyment. Some characters excel at zoning with projectiles, while others rely on aggressive rushdown to overwhelm opponents. Think about whether you prefer fast, floaty movement or grounded, technical tools before committing to a main.

Finding Stable Connections and Lobbies

A smooth connection is the backbone of any good Street Fighter Alpha 3 online experience, and rollback netcode has become the standard for competitive play. Look for lobbies that prioritize low ping and stable frames per second, since even small delays can affect your timing on command grabs and special moves.

Here are practical tips for better online sessions:

  • Use a wired ethernet connection instead of Wi Fi when possible.
  • Close background applications that might consume bandwidth.
  • Choose servers that are geographically close to your location.
Some platforms also offer region locking or ping filters, which help you avoid lag spikes that ruin the rhythm of a match. With the right setup, you can enjoy responsive battles that feel almost like being in the same room.

Improving Through Training and Match Analysis

Progress in Street Fighter Alpha 3 online comes down to deliberate practice and a willingness to learn from losses. Spend time in training mode drilling combos, links, and defensive options until they work under pressure. Recording your matches, whether by external software or built in tools, lets you review mistakes and spot patterns in your opponent's gameplan.

Consider these practice habits:

  • Set specific goals for each session, such as mastering a single combo or practicing anti airs.
  • Study high level replays from top players to understand spacing and timing choices.
  • Simulate common match scenarios, like defending against tick throws or punishing jump ins.
Over time, these habits will translate into more consistent results and a deeper understanding of the game's nuances.
